James has developed his own style of healing called SomaBodywork. His innovative
style fuses the contemporary knowledge of anatomy, physiology, kinesiology and biomechanics
with bodywork and other healing techniques.
This powerful healing system gives him many avenues to work from. His deep knowledge
of anatomy provides a foundation that allows him to see structural imbalances in
the body so he can tailor the work to meet the needs of each client. During his
25 years of professional practice, he has seen all types of injury and imbalance,
which he used to hone his system.
He studied at the Rolf Institute in Boulder, Colorado and later took the Shiatsu
program at the Ohashi Center in New York City. He is certified in Neuromuscular
Therapy from the Saint John’s Neuromuscular Pain Relief Institute.
James ran a yoga school and healing center in San Francisco for Thirteen years.
He now practices in Los Angeles and San Francisco and has clients around the world.
